Since 2015, CityLab010 has supported plans for Rotterdam. Through CityLab, the Municipality of Rotterdam finances plans from entrepreneurs that make the city greener, more social, and safer. How are the CityLab initiatives from back then doing? Former participant Luz Adriana Jaramillo tells.
Empowering women in Rotterdam against violence. That was Jaramillos goal. So she submitted in 2022 her project Woman & Powerful. Link opens an external page to CityLab010 (hereafter: CityLab). Through CityLab . Link opens an external page the municipality provides money and support to entrepreneurs who have a good idea for Rotterdam and want to implement it. Jaramillo received such a CityLab grant and shares about her project.
Domestic Violence
‘I have always been into kickboxing. Yet, I also experienced domestic violence. Even though I was physically resilient, I could fight. That made me realize: outside the ring, on the street, but unfortunately also at home, self-defense is different from fighting. That inspired me to start Woman & Powerful.’
Like First Aid
‘Violence against women unfortunately occurs everywhere. It is not the responsibility of women to combat that violence. But I want to make women aware of their possibilities. I see my resilience training as first aid: it’s good to know the knowledge and skills, but hopefully, the women never have to apply them.’
Scary Guy
‘In my training sessions, I prepare women step by step for a physical confrontation with a “Scary Guy”. He’s not that scary; he’s a trainer, but it’s about simulating a threatening situation and experiencing the associated stress. Leading up to that confrontation, I teach the women how they can protect their safety first with words and their demeanor. If that doesn’t work, then it’s time to deliver the pain: a solid hit or kick to a sensitive spot.’
Stress Level Up
‘In the last lesson, that Scary Guy comes in. He greets no one. That activates a dangerous situation. If that Scary Guy finally harasses a woman, she may defend herself. Yes, sometimes there are hits. Fortunately, this Scary Guy is trained to take it, haha!’
Springboard
‘CityLab worked for me as a springboard. When I started, I focused on Hoogvliet. Now I have a larger reach and give my training sessions in Kralingen. Link opens an external page. To women aged 12 to fifty. I see those women coming closer together during the training sessions, which is beautiful to see.’
New Work
‘My participation in CityLab has also earned me new work. I am now involved in the municipalitys approach to sexual street harassment. Link opens an external page. There I help not only victims who have reported via the STOP app. Link opens an external page. I also go to schools, provide workshops, and awareness sessions about inappropriate behavior to reach young people.’
Lady Next Door
‘I think it helps for my training that I don’t look like the stereotypical fighter. I look like the lady next door. What does that say? Every woman who sees me can identify with me and knows: if she could learn it, I can too!’
